La aplicación no pudo iniciarse correctamente (0xc0000142)
Buscando en Google no se encuentra mucho, pero parece indicar que esto no es nada específico de Delphi y ocurre con otras aplicaciones. Parece ser causado por la llamada a una DLL de 32 bits desde una aplicación de 64 bits o viceversa.
No se ha podido resolver una dependencia del tiempo de carga. La forma más fácil de depurar esto es utilizar el Andador de Dependencias. Utilice la opción Perfil para obtener la salida de diagnóstico del proceso de carga. Esto identificará el punto de fallo y debería guiarle hacia una solución.
Intenté todas las cosas especificadas aquí y encontré otra respuesta. Tuve que compilar mi aplicación con DLLs de 32 bits. Había construido las bibliotecas tanto en 32 bits como en 64 bits, pero tenía mi PATH configurado para las bibliotecas de 64 bits. Después de recompilar mi aplicación (con una serie de cambios en mi código también) obtuve este temido error y luché durante dos días. Finalmente, después de probar otras cosas, cambié mi PATH para tener las DLL de 32 bits antes de las de 64 bits (tienen los mismos nombres). Y funcionó. Lo añado aquí para completarlo.
A veces la aplicación que quieres ejecutar puede contener algo que se ha corrompido. En este caso, debes desinstalar la aplicación por completo y volver a instalarla. Después de eso ejecute el programa y vea si su problema se resuelve.
De hecho, en muchos casos el error “La aplicación no pudo iniciarse correctamente” es el resultado de problemas en el marco de Microsoft .NET. (.NET framework es un marco desarrollado por Microsoft que da soporte a las aplicaciones que utilizan tecnologías .Net). Es posible que tenga que reinstalarlo para solucionar el problema.
* El marco Microsoft .NET ha sido parte integral de Windows 8 y 10. No se puede eliminar o reinstalar manualmente. Por lo tanto, los pasos que se indican a continuación sólo pueden aplicarse a Windows 7 o a versiones anteriores. Para los usuarios de Windows 10/8, puede intentar actualizar su Windows para instalar el último .NET framework (si lo hay).
b) Introduzca “chkdsk c: /f /r”. (Esto significa que va a comprobar y reparar la unidad C. Si quieres comprobar otra unidad, sustituye “c” por la letra correspondiente de esa unidad). Siga las instrucciones para completar el proceso.
Plutonio 0xc000007b
“Busqué este error en línea y vi muchas páginas web relacionadas con el error. Las soluciones sugeridas eran para Windows Vista/7/8/8.1, pero yo necesito arreglarlo en Windows 10. Es más, mi aplicación de correo electrónico no funcionaba, y lo arreglé descargando Visual C++ Redistributable para Visual Studio 2012 Update 4. Estoy usando un escritorio con Windows 10, i3-2100 CPU, 8GB RAM, 2TB Seagate HDD. ¿Hay alguna solución fácil para arreglar el error para Windows 10? Por favor, ayuda”.
Este error de imposibilidad de inicio es un problema que le ocurre a las aplicaciones en el ordenador Windows y puede ser un problema estresante. Pero este error no significa necesariamente que es más allá de la reparación o el final del software involucrado. Debe haber ciertas razones que conducen al error cuando se intenta ejecutar el software. Usted será capaz de solucionar el problema después de intentar varios pasos de solución de problemas aquí.
El código de error significa un formato de imagen no válido. En concreto, está intentando iniciar una aplicación que está diseñada para ejecutarse en un sistema operativo de 64 bits. Pero su ordenador está ejecutando Windows de 32 bits. La aplicación de 32 bits no puede cargar una dll de 64 bits, por lo que la mezcla de 32 bits con el entorno de 64 bits provoca el problema.
RESTORO es una gran herramienta de reparación que encuentra y repara automáticamente diferentes problemas en el sistema operativo Windows. Tener esta herramienta protegerá su PC contra códigos maliciosos, fallos de hardware y varios otros errores. Además, esto también le asegura el uso de su dispositivo a su máxima capacidad y rendimiento.
Varios usuarios han informado de que han solucionado este error simplemente descargando un archivo xinput1_3.dll y colocándolo en la carpeta requerida. Para confirmar si este es el caso o no, vaya a la ruta – C:\Windows\SysWOW64, y busque este archivo DLL. En caso de que no encuentre dicho archivo, puede obtenerlo de un sitio oficial.
Puede intentar ejecutar el comando CHKDSK si ninguna de las soluciones que ha probado anteriormente funciona. Cuando ejecutes este programa, escaneará el disco duro de tu ordenador y reparará los problemas si los encuentra. Para ejecutar CHKDSK, sigue estos pasos: